The Bellevue tech landscape is diverse, dominated by giants like Amazon, which has significantly expanded its corporate footprint in downtown Bellevue, and major players such as T-Mobile and Salesforce. The region excels in cloud computing, e-commerce, gaming (with studios like Bungie nearby), and advanced software development. Professionals will find opportunities spanning from cutting-edge AI research to scalable enterprise solutions, reflecting Bellevue's position at the forefront of technological innovation.

What types of tech jobs are most common in Bellevue, WA?
Bellevue's tech sector offers a wide array of roles. You'll find strong demand for Software Development Engineers, Cloud Architects, Data Scientists, Product Managers, and UX/UI Designers. Specialties often include cloud services (AWS, Azure), e-commerce platforms, gaming development, and enterprise software solutions, driven by major employers and numerous startups across the city.
What is the current trend for remote versus on-site tech jobs in Bellevue?
While many Bellevue tech companies initially embraced remote work, there's a noticeable shift towards hybrid models, with many roles requiring 2-3 days in the office, especially in downtown Bellevue. Fully on-site positions are also common, particularly for roles requiring specialized hardware or direct team collaboration. Fully remote opportunities still exist but may be less prevalent than a few years ago, depending on the company and team structure.
Which major tech companies are significant employers in Bellevue, WA?
Bellevue is home to key operations for tech giants. <strong>Amazon</strong> has a substantial and growing presence, particularly in downtown Bellevue. Other major employers include <strong>T-Mobile</strong>, <strong>Salesforce</strong>, and various divisions of <strong>Microsoft</strong> (though their main campus is in nearby Redmond). Additionally, companies like <strong>Expedia Group</strong> and several prominent gaming studios contribute significantly to the local job market.
What are the salary expectations for tech professionals in Bellevue, WA?
Tech salaries in Bellevue are generally competitive and among the highest nationally, reflecting the high cost of living and concentration of top-tier companies. For a Software Engineer, entry-level salaries might start around $100k-$130k, with experienced professionals earning $180k-$250k+, excluding equity and bonuses. What advice do you have for tech professionals relocating to Bellevue, WA?
Relocating to Bellevue requires careful planning due to its high cost of living, especially for housing. Research neighborhoods like Downtown Bellevue for urban living, or Factoria/Crossroads for slightly more suburban options, considering commute times to major tech campuses. Factor in Washington's lack of state income tax, which can impact take-home pay.
